Ingredients for French Coconut Pie
- 1 1/2 cups shredded coconut (sweetened or unsweetened, your choice!)
- 1 cup granulated sugar (this adds that perfect sweetness)
- 1/2 cup unsalted butter, melted (don’t skip this—it makes the filling so rich!)
- 3 large eggs (beaten, to give it that lovely structure)
- 1 cup milk (whole milk works best for creaminess)
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ract (trust me, it elevates the flavor!)
- 1 pie crust (store-bought or homemade, whatever you prefer)
How to Prepare French Coconut Pie
Alright, let’s dive into the magic of making this French coconut pie! It’s super simple, and I promise you’ll be rewarded with an incredible dessert that will impress everyone. Just follow these steps, and you’ll have a delightful pie ready in no time!
Step-by-Step Instructions
-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). This is a crucial step, so don’t skip it! You want the oven hot and ready to bake that pie.
- In a large mixing bowl, combine the granulated sugar and melted butter. Mix them together until it’s nice and smooth.
- Next, add the beaten eggs, milk, and vanilla extract into the bowl. Stir everything together well—this is where the magic starts happening!
- Now, gently fold in the shredded coconut. Make sure it’s evenly distributed, as each slice should have that delicious coconut goodness.
- Pour the coconut mixture into your prepared pie crust. Don’t worry if it looks a little full; it will bake beautifully!
- Bake in the preheated oven for 30–35 minutes. You’ll know it’s ready when the pie is set and slightly golden on top. It’s okay if the center has a slight jiggle; it will firm up as it cools.
- Once baked, remove the pie from the oven and let it cool completely at room temperature. Trust me, this cooling part is essential for the flavors to meld.

Tips for Success
Want to make sure your French coconut pie turns out absolutely perfect? I’ve got you covered! Here are some of my tried-and-true tips:
- Use fresh coconut: If you can find fresh coconut, it really enhances the flavor. But if not, the shredded variety works just fine!
- Don’t overmix: When you’re combining the ingredients, mix just until everything is incorporated. Overmixing can lead to a tough texture, and we want that creamy filling to shine!
- Check for doneness: The pie should be set but still slightly jiggly in the center when you take it out. It’ll firm up as it cools, so don’t worry if it looks a little wobbly!
- Chill before serving: For the best flavor, let the pie chill in the fridge for a couple of hours before slicing. It makes a world of difference!
- Experiment with toppings: Consider adding a dollop of whipped cream or a sprinkle of toasted coconut on top for that extra flair!

Storage & Reheating Instructions
Got leftovers? No problem! Storing your French coconut pie is super easy. Just cover it tightly with plastic wrap or aluminum foil to keep it fresh, and pop it in the fridge. It’ll stay delicious for up to 3 days—though I doubt it’ll last that long because it’s so good!
If you want to enjoy it warm, simply preheat your oven to 300°F (150°C) and place the pie on a baking sheet. Heat for about 10-15 minutes, or until it’s warmed through. This way, the creamy filling stays nice and soft without drying out. Just be careful not to overdo it! You can also enjoy it chilled, which is equally delightful—especially during warmer months. FAQ About French Coconut Pie
Got questions about making this delightful French coconut pie? You’re not alone! Here are some of the most common inquiries I get, along with my best tips:
- Can I use sweetened shredded coconut instead of unsweetened? Absolutely! Sweetened shredded coconut adds a lovely sweetness, which pairs beautifully with the creamy filling. Just keep in mind that it’ll make the pie a bit sweeter overall.
- What can I serve with French coconut pie? I love to serve my pie with a dollop of whipped cream or a scoop of vanilla ice cream on the side. Fresh fruit, like berries or sliced bananas, also makes a lovely addition!
- Can I make this pie ahead of time? Yes, you can! This pie actually tastes even better after chilling in the fridge for a few hours. Just cover it tightly, and it will stay fresh for up to 3 days.
- What if I don’t have a pie crust? No worries! You can use a graham cracker crust or even make a crustless version by simply greasing the pie dish. It will still taste amazing!
- Can I freeze French coconut pie? Yes, you can freeze it! Just wrap it tightly in plastic wrap and aluminum foil. When you’re ready to enjoy it, let it thaw in the fridge overnight and serve chilled or warm.
